From 0660849bdcc2e397f3b596efbc57a0282c4762d2 Mon Sep 17 00:00:00 2001 From: Chris Ostrouchov Date: Wed, 17 Oct 2018 00:54:42 -0400 Subject: [PATCH] pythonPackages.netifaces: refactor move to python-modules --- .../python-modules/netifaces/default.nix | 21 +++++++++++++++++++ pkgs/top-level/python-packages.nix | 15 +------------ 2 files changed, 22 insertions(+), 14 deletions(-) create mode 100644 pkgs/development/python-modules/netifaces/default.nix diff --git a/pkgs/development/python-modules/netifaces/default.nix b/pkgs/development/python-modules/netifaces/default.nix new file mode 100644 index 00000000000..8f762fb0c3d --- /dev/null +++ b/pkgs/development/python-modules/netifaces/default.nix @@ -0,0 +1,21 @@ +{ stdenv +, buildPythonPackage +, fetchPypi +}: + +buildPythonPackage rec { + version = "0.10.6"; + pname = "netifaces"; + + src = fetchPypi { + inherit pname version; + sha256 = "1q7bi5k2r955rlcpspx4salvkkpk28jky67fjbpz2dkdycisak8c"; + }; + + meta = with stdenv.lib; { + homepage = https://alastairs-place.net/projects/netifaces/; + description = "Portable access to network interfaces from Python"; + license = licenses.mit; + }; + +} diff --git a/pkgs/top-level/python-packages.nix b/pkgs/top-level/python-packages.nix index a315b01c419..08397746646 100644 --- a/pkgs/top-level/python-packages.nix +++ b/pkgs/top-level/python-packages.nix @@ -2955,20 +2955,7 @@ in { netaddr = callPackage ../development/python-modules/netaddr { }; - netifaces = buildPythonPackage rec { - version = "0.10.6"; - name = "netifaces-${version}"; - - src = pkgs.fetchurl { - url = "mirror://pypi/n/netifaces/${name}.tar.gz"; - sha256 = "1q7bi5k2r955rlcpspx4salvkkpk28jky67fjbpz2dkdycisak8c"; - }; - - meta = { - homepage = https://alastairs-place.net/projects/netifaces/; - description = "Portable access to network interfaces from Python"; - }; - }; + netifaces = callPackage ../development/python-modules/netifaces { }; hpack = buildPythonPackage rec { name = "hpack-${version}";